playwright_evaluate
Execute JavaScript code directly in the browser console to automate web interactions, extract data, or manipulate page elements during browser automation sessions.

Implementation Reference
- src/tools/browser/interaction.ts:236-255 (handler)The EvaluateTool class implements the core logic for the playwright_evaluate tool by executing the provided JavaScript script on the browser page using page.evaluate and returning the result.export class EvaluateTool extends BrowserToolBase { /** * Execute the evaluate tool */ async execute(args: any, context: ToolContext): Promise<ToolResponse> { return this.safeExecute(context, async (page) => { const result = await page.evaluate(args.script); // Convert result to string for display let resultStr: string; try { resultStr = JSON.stringify(result, null, 2); } catch (_error) { resultStr = String(result); } return createSuccessResponse([`Executed JavaScript:`, `${args.script}`, `Result:`, `${resultStr}`]); }); } }
- src/tools.ts:227-236 (schema)Schema definition for the playwright_evaluate tool, specifying the input parameters.name: "playwright_evaluate", description: "Execute JavaScript in the browser console", inputSchema: { type: "object", properties: { script: { type: "string", description: "JavaScript code to execute" }, }, required: ["script"], }, },
- src/toolHandler.ts:606-607 (registration)Tool registration in the main handleToolCall switch statement, which dispatches calls to the EvaluateTool instance.case "playwright_evaluate": return await evaluateTool.execute(args, context);
- src/toolHandler.ts:399-399 (registration)Instantiation of the EvaluateTool instance during tool initialization.if (!evaluateTool) evaluateTool = new EvaluateTool(server);
- src/tools.ts:503-503 (helper)Inclusion in BROWSER_TOOLS array used to determine browser requirements."playwright_evaluate",
